Nuit et Brouillard (1956)
1955 : Alain Resnais, à la demande du comité d'histoire de la Seconde Guerre mondiale, se rend sur les lieux où des milliers d'hommes, de femmes et d'enfants ont perdu la vie. Il s'agit d'Orianenbourg, Auschwitz, Dachau, Ravensbruck, Belsen, Neuengamme, Struthof. Avec Jean Cayrol et l'aide de documents d'archives, il retrace le lent calvaire des déportés.
